在idea操作Excel需要在pom.xml中引入什么依赖,介绍一下
时间: 2024-03-03 17:53:40 浏览: 38
要在IDEA中操作Excel,需要在pom.xml中引入Apache POI库的依赖。Apache POI是一个用Java编写的库,可以用于读写Microsoft Office格式的文件,包括Excel、Word和PowerPoint等。以下是在pom.xml中引入Apache POI库的依赖的示例代码:
```
<dependency>
<groupId>org.apache.poi</groupId>
<artifactId>poi</artifactId>
<version>4.1.2</version>
</dependency>
<dependency>
<groupId>org.apache.poi</groupId>
<artifactId>poi-ooxml</artifactId>
<version>4.1.2</version>
</dependency>
```
其中,第一个依赖是用于操作Excel 97-2003格式的文件,第二个依赖是用于操作Excel 2007及以上版本的文件。通过引入这两个依赖,就可以使用Apache POI库提供的API来读写Excel文件了。
相关问题
如何在idea中项目的pom.xml文件中添加依赖
在 IntelliJ IDEA 中,可以按照以下步骤向 Maven 项目的 `pom.xml` 文件中添加依赖:
1. 打开 IntelliJ IDEA 中的 Maven 项目,将光标移动到 `pom.xml` 文件中您想要添加依赖的位置。
2. 在 `pom.xml` 文件中的 `<dependencies>` 标签中,添加依赖的坐标信息。例如,如果您想要添加 Spring Framework 核心库的依赖,可以将以下内容添加到 `<dependencies>` 标签中:
```xml
<dependency>
<groupId>org.springframework</groupId>
<artifactId>spring-core</artifactId>
<version>5.3.8</version>
</dependency>
```
3. 点击 IntelliJ IDEA 上方的 `Reimport All Maven Projects` 按钮(或使用快捷键 `Ctrl + Shift + A`,然后输入“Reimport All Maven Projects”来执行)以重新导入 Maven 项目并更新依赖关系。
4. 等待 Maven 项目重新导入后,就可以在您的项目中使用添加的依赖了。
请注意,如果您使用的是较旧版本的 IntelliJ IDEA,可能需要手动保存 `pom.xml` 文件才能使更改生效。在最新版本的 IntelliJ IDEA 中,更改将自动保存并重新导入 Maven 项目。
idea在lib目录下添加jar包后还需要在pom.xml中配置吗
如果您在 IntelliJ IDEA 的 lib 目录下手动添加了一个 JAR 文件,通常情况下是不需要在 pom.xml 文件中进行额外的配置的。
IntelliJ IDEA 使用 Maven 作为默认的构建工具,当您将 JAR 文件添加到 lib 目录下时,IDEA 会自动将其添加到项目的类路径中。这意味着您可以在代码中直接使用该 JAR 文件中的类和资源,而无需在 pom.xml 文件中添加任何依赖项。
然而,如果您希望在构建和部署项目时自动处理这个依赖关系,以确保其他开发人员在不同的环境中能够正确地构建项目,那么最好将该依赖项添加到 pom.xml 文件中。通过在 pom.xml 文件中定义依赖项,可以确保构建工具(如 Maven)在构建项目时正确地处理和解析依赖关系。
总结起来,尽管不是必需的,但在 pom.xml 文件中配置依赖项通常是一种良好的实践,可以提高项目的可移植性和一致性。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)